Today's Highlight in History:

  • On Nov. 15, 1806, explorer Zebulon Pike sighted the mountaintop now known as "Pikes Peak" in present-day Colorado.
  • In 1708, British statesman William Pitt the Elder was born in London.
  • In 1777, the Second Continental Congress approved the Articles of Confederation, a precursor to the Constitution of the United States.
  • In 1889, Brazil was proclaimed a republic as its emperor, Dom Pedro II, was overthrown.
  • In 1908, China's Empress Dowager Cixi died two weeks short of her 73rd birthday.
  • In 1939, President Roosevelt laid the cornerstone of the Jefferson Memorial in Washington, D.C.
  • In 1948, William Lyon Mackenzie King retired as prime minister of Canada after 21 years; he was succeeded by Louis St. Laurent.
  • In 1958, actor Tyrone Power died in Madrid, Spain, at age 44 while filming "Solomon and Sheba."
  • In 1966, the flight of Gemini 12 ended successfully as astronauts James A. Lovell and Edwin "Buzz" Aldrin Junior splashed down safely in the Atlantic.
  • Five years ago: Two Black Hawk helicopters collided and crashed in Iraq; 17 U.S. troops were killed. Two synagogues were bombed in Istanbul; 29 people were killed. A gangway on the cruise ship RMS Queen Mary 2 collapsed in St. Nazaire, France, killing 15 people. Democrat Kathleen Blanco was elected the first female governor of Louisiana, defeating Republican Bobby Jindal in a runoff. Death claimed billionaire Laurence Tisch at age 80 and actress Dorothy Loudon at age 70.
